“God is the Father, individually, of every single human being: He has with him or her a unique personal relationship. In the eyes of God we are all children . . . Every one of us is wanted and is loved by God . . . In this relationship with God we can become what we truly are through faith, deep personal acceptance, a ‘yes’ to God who is the origin and foundation of our existence and welcoming life as a gift from the Father who is in heaven . . . A Father who is infinitely good and loyal to us” (General Address before the Angelus, 1/8/12).
